Hey, McGill alumnus here. It seems like you already established that McGill is more academically favourable, and now what is left is the choice between both cities. I have been to Tokyo as a tourist as well, and was in Montreal for 5 years. Montreal has often been ranked one of the best cities in the world for students, because of…. Well, everything ! Choosing Montreal over Tokyo for a semester abroad usually just makes life easier and more rewarding overall: you can function fully in English, integrate faster socially and academically, deal with housing and bureaucracy without constant friction, and enjoy a university culture that’s closer to what most Western students are used to (more discussion, less hierarchy). It’s also easier to budget, easier to work part-time legally, and easier to build real friendships instead of staying on the outside looking in. Tokyo is incredible, but for a short stay it can be mentally exhausting: language barriers, strict social norms, tiny housing, and higher hidden costs add up quickly. Montreal still gives you strong cultural exposure and international credibility, but with far less stress and much higher day-to-day quality of life, which matters a lot over a single semester.

Is a PhD at University of Sao Paulo a good idea? by [deleted] in gradadmissions

[–]rogerdm 1 point2 points  (0 children)

It depends of your other choices. USP is one of the best schools in Latin America and produces a lot of scientific and academic work, but it is a Brazilian university and it is not internationalized as universities in Europe. If you don’t speak Portuguese, you will struggle at times. The academic environment might be safe because of English, but if you don’t speak Portuguese you will miss out on the cultural opportunities. By the way, make sure your application is accepted. In Brazil you don’t get a PhD placement because one professor decides to accept you, the process must be done through the admissions office and the call for applications is an official document with legal bindings.
